Lightgallery是一个现代的、基于电子和nodejs的图像浏览器,适用于Mac、Windows和Linux,Lightgallery使用Electron构建,拥有大量精美的内置动画!有需要的小伙伴欢迎来西西下载体验。
软件功能:
使用Electron构建。
LightGallery使用HTML、CSS和JavaScript与Chromium和Node.js来构建应用程序。
跨平台。
LightGallery可以跨操作系统工作。你可以在OS X、Windows或Linux上使用它。
20多种动画
LightGallery自带了大量精美的内置动画。
动画缩略图
您还可以在设置中选择启用动画缩略图。
缩放和全屏
您可以双击图像,查看其实际尺寸。可以使用放大和缩小控件来改变图像的缩放值。
鼠标拖动和键盘导航
LightGallery允许用户通过鼠标拖动和键盘箭头在幻灯片之间进行导航。
寻呼机
自動幻燈片
支持各种图片格式(jpg、png、gif、webp)。
高度可定制化使用方法:
使用方法:
在页面中引入lightgallery.css和lightgallery.min.js文件。如果你需要某项功能可以单独引入相关文件,如全屏功能引入lg-fullscreen.min.js,缩略图功能引入lg-thumbnail.min.js等。
<link rel="stylesheet" href="css/lightgallery.css">
<script src="js/lightgallery.min.js"></script>
<script src="js/lg-thumbnail.min.js"></script>
<script src="js/lg-fullscreen.min.js"></script>
...
HTML结构
建议使用下面的HTML结构来构建一个图片画廊。
<div id="lightgallery">
<a href="img/img1.jpg">
<img src="img/thumb1.jpg">
</a>
<a href="img/img2.jpg">
<img src="img/thumb2.jpg">
</a>
...
</div>
你可以查看这里来获取其它HTML结构的使用方法。
初始化插件
在页面底部通过下面的方法来初始化该lightbox插件。
<script>
lightGallery(document.getElementById('lightgallery'));
</script>